Web 高级着色语言(WHLSL) - 为WebGPU设计的Web图形着色语言

初商 2019-08-06

UC国际技术

image.png

原文作者:Myles Maxfield @Litherum

译者:UC 国际研发 Jothy

----

本文介绍了一种新的 Web 图形着色语言:Web 高级着色语言(WHLSL,发音为 “whistle”)。 这种语言受 HLSL 的启发,HLSL 是图形应用开发人员用的主要着色语言。 它扩展了 Web 平台的 HLSL,使其安全可靠。 它易于阅读和编写,使用了正式技术而可以很好地指定。

背景

在过去的几十年中,3D 图形已经发生了重大变化,程序员用来编写 3D 应用的 API 也发生了相应的变化。五年前,最先进的图形应用使用 OpenGL 来执行渲染。然而,在过去几年中,3D 图形行业正朝着更新,更低级别的图形框架转变,这种框架更符合真实硬件的行为。 2014 年,Apple 创建了 Metal 框架,让 iOS 和 macOS 应用





登录 后评论
下一篇
corcosa
16449人浏览
2019-10-08
相关推荐
css 3d样子
521人浏览
2011-11-25 10:20:00
OGRE材质
1796人浏览
2016-05-19 16:25:25
C&C++图形图像处理开源库
1335人浏览
2017-05-27 17:23:00
WebGL初探
863人浏览
2017-08-01 11:49:00
数据可视化概览
660人浏览
2019-10-08 18:27:19
0
0
0
507